摘要
With the deepening of the concept of sustainable development, a green economy has become the primary goal of urban development. Therefore, to improve the sustainability and far-reaching development of the urban economy, this work first discusses the concept of sustainable development. Second, the concept of a "green economy" is discussed. Lastly, based on the concept of green economic development, this work studies carbon emissions in Hebei Province, China, and discusses the impact of carbon emissions on the urban economy. On this basis, the impact of carbon intensity and CO2 emissions on economic growth is analyzed by establishing an endogenous growth model and state-space model, thereby revealing the importance of carbon emissions to the economic development of Hebei Province. In the analysis process, sensitivity analysis and a robustness test are also used to verify the reliability and robustness of the model results. Finally, this work summarizes the research conclusions and puts forward relevant policy suggestions, which provide a reference for developing a green economy in Hebei Province. The results reveal that from 1999 to 2020, the average output elasticity of labor, capital, and CO2 in Hebei Province are 0.4002, 0.3057, and 0.2941, respectively. This shows that carbon emissions are essential to Hebei's economic growth. In other words, Hebei's economic development mainly depends on enterprises with high carbon emissions. Additionally, in the optimistic case, Hebei's potential output growth rate will show a downward trend, but will soon rise. This indicates that even under strict carbon emission control, Hebei's economic growth rate will still pick up based on the support of high-tech. This work not only provides a reference for the development of Hebei's green economic system, but also contributes to the sustainable development of the urban economy in the future.
